if I have got 150 marks in jee mains then what is my percentile

Hello aspirant,

If you have scored 150 marks in Jee mains 2019 then your percentile will be somewhere between 98.25-98.3, however some point difference can be there.

This year JEE results are based on performance in  slotwise.

Check your JEE results

It has been widely reported that students scoring low got a better rank than the one who scored more marks .

The percentile is taken slot wise

Difficulty level is different for each slot also the competition
